Transaction 5e06b668013ef956bd735980f9a92e3dd8533c791890fb96fc840581434e6c89
3 Input
2 Outputs
- 5e06b668013ef956bd735980f9a92e3dd8533c791890fb96fc840581434e6c89:0
- 5e06b668013ef956bd735980f9a92e3dd8533c791890fb96fc840581434e6c89:1
value 571486
address 1AjRA5EjqMDMBpHg3kaua3WjpMiZCLaBEH
value 4886875
address 1BDmcbPDa9hutfSSjJYmADZg6ocnPB3vZk